One block from the Hudson River on a quiet dead-end street, this stunning 5-bedroom, 2.5-bath home beautifully blends historic Arts & Crafts charm with thoughtful modern updates. Built circa 1905, this meticulously restored Four Square Colonial showcases the timeless appeal of early 20th-century design, featuring wide oak moldings, elegant leaded and stained glass windows, pocket doors, and classic William Morris wallpaper. Generously proportioned rooms flow seamlessly around a central staircase, creating a warm and inviting layout ideal for both entertaining and everyday living. The spacious eat-in kitchen boasts slate tile floors, quartz countertops, abundant cabinetry, a Sub-Zero refrigerator, Ilve oven, and a secondary open staircase for added convenience. A separate family room offers a wall of windows overlooking the beautifully landscaped backyard and expansive bluestone patio for outdoor gatherings. Additional highlights include a detached two-car garage with a modern office/studio above, a welcoming lemonade front porch, fully fenced front and back yards for added privacy, and a whole-house generator for peace of mind. Located just a short distance from the village, the path, and the Hudson River, this exceptional home is a rare opportunity to own a turn-of-the-century masterpiece in Nyack.
